Is the AprilAire 413 good for allergy reduction?
It appears well suited to allergy-focused home use because it is a MERV 13 replacement filter designed to capture common airborne particles such as pollen, dust, pet dander and mold spores. Buyer feedback also repeatedly mentions reduced dust and improved day-to-day air quality, although results will still depend on the overall HVAC system and replacement schedule.
Is the AprilAire 413 easy to install?
Yes. This is one of the product’s clearest strengths. It uses a slide-in design and customer feedback consistently describes it as easy to fit, especially in compatible AprilAire units. The main thing to check before buying is exact model compatibility, since some systems require the AprilAire upgrade kit.
How often should the AprilAire 413 be replaced?
The product guidance says to replace it at least once a year to maintain performance. In practice, some users report replacing it every six months depending on dust levels, household conditions and HVAC use. Homes with heavier particle loads may need more frequent changes than the stated annual interval.

Which systems is the AprilAire 413 compatible with?
It is listed for several AprilAire models including 1410, 1610, 2410, 2416, 3410 and 4400, with some additional compatibility for 2140 and 2400 when upgrade kit 1413 is installed. Buyers should confirm their exact system model before ordering, because this is not a universal air filter.
Does the AprilAire 413 have smart home features?
Not in the usual connected-device sense. The product mentions the Healthy Air App for replacement reminders and indoor air quality maintenance guidance, but there is no evidence here of broader smart home integration, automation platforms or advanced app-based control. It is primarily a replacement filter rather than a smart appliance.
What are the main drawbacks of the AprilAire 413?
The biggest drawback is price, especially for households replacing multiple filters or changing them more often than once a year. It is also limited to compatible AprilAire systems, so buyers must verify fit carefully. Beyond that, its connected features are minimal and mostly limited to reminder support.
